    Who is Dr. Ostrup, Neurosurgeon in San Diego, CA?

    Dr. Richard Ostrup, MD is a Neurosurgeon, who primarily practices in San Diego, CA with 2 additional practice locations. He has been practicing for over 39 years and is board certified. Dr. Ostrup completed his residency at UCSD Medical Center, San Diego. Dr. Ostrup is fluent in English and Spanish,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Ostrup’s practice accepts Kaiser Permanente, Medicaid,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ans. A neurological surgeon is responsible to provide the operative and non-operative management which includes prevention, diagnosis, evaluation, treatment, critical care, & rehabilitation of various disorders related to the central, peripheral, and autonomic nervous systems. This includes their supporting structures and vascular supply, the complete evaluation and treatment of pathological process which is known to modify function or activity of the nervous system, the operative & non-operative management of pain. A neurological surgeon has specialization in treating patients with disorders of the nervous system which includes conditions affecting the brain, meninges, skull, and their blood supply, such as the extracranial carotid and vertebral arteries. They also manage disorders related to the pituitary gland, spinal cord, meninges, and vertebral column, including those that may require spinal fusion or instrumentation.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ise.
